A blown head gasket can cause overheating, coolant loss, and even catastrophic engine failure if you don’t catch it in time The head gasket is a seal between the engine block and the cylinder head, and if it fails, it can cause oil and coolant mixing, overheating, and engine damage. That’s why knowing how to test for a head gasket leak is critical if you suspect a head gasket failure

Head gaskets may not be the most glamorous part of your car’s engine, but their role is critical When the head gasket fails or “blows,” it can lead to a host of engine problems, some minor but many severe Recognizing the early warning signs can save you from costly repairs — or even worse, from replacing your engine altogether. The head gasket is located between these two sections

While your engine runs, the head gasket’s job is to seal the pressure from the firing cylinders It also keeps the oil and coolant separate and prevents them from leaking If your engine is operating under too much heat, the gasket can fail.
